Now the funny story... my boys have a new hobby this summer... fighting!!! I am so sick of the constant arguing, bickering, etc which usually leads to someone hitting, pinching, chasing, and occasionally biting. SO.... a friend of mine from church (who has 2 older kids who are so well behaved now) gave me some advice on it... she told me to try what she had done when her kids were little, so I did... I told them when they fought that they had to go out in the back yard. I locked the door (but I peaked thru the window without them seeing me) and they could fight all they wanted out there. This takes the fun out of it by telling them they can do it. I was a little worried how my BOYS would respond to this, butI tried it... I said, "You can kick, hit, bite, pinch, chase, what ever you want to do, but you are not going to do it in my house!" So I locked Coby and Micah out there and they just looked stunned...
I heard Coby say, "did mommy say we could bite and hit?"
Then Micah, "Yes, but please dont hit me or bite!"
C: "OK, Micah, I have a great idea... how bout you dont hurt me and I wont hurt you, k?" (what a novel idea!)
M: "yeah... great idea... you wanna go play dumptrucks in the sand box?"
C (big smile): "yeah!"
And off they went......
Between the 3 of them, we did this 4 times yesterday and by the end of the day they were pretty much working things out themselves without being banished to the back yard! :o)
